Whoa whoa whoa... hold on now. I did not say that to come across as snobby. I love console gaming and I've chosen certain games for my 360 over the PC version. All I am saying is that it is time for a new generation of consoles. The technology has fallen behind enough now that in a year or two it will be necessary. Remember the 360 is six years old now. This thing isn't going to be in the store tomorrow.

Of course a PC will always be more powerful but the gap is becoming too wide. I think it is fair to compare them though. Game development in the past 3 or 4 years had shifted to the console market. The PC was really left at the wayside. Most games were simply ported over to the PC and were routinely given better reviews on the Xbox. Hell, some even looked better. Not anymore. Now we're starting to see games that look and perform better on the PC. I'd like to see that gap shortened again.
